10,000 Gifts
With over 10,000 years of local history, Quw'utsun elders walk alongside the students and staff of a small Cowichan Valley school that is demonstrating the humility and courage required for reconciliAction.

Arianna is a Coast Salish woman of mixed ancestry, an artist, and a storyteller. It is her passion to visually capture and showcase her heritage and community through art and film. As the co-owner of Keywork Productions she has worked on a variety of small-scale and independent video projects and takes on a wide range of roles. Art has always been a part of her life but expressing it through film is an exploration of the past 5 years. 10,000 Gifts is Augustine’s first producing and directing credit.yet. With a commitment to taking up Truth and Reconciliation, she is working to decolonize her practice and understand her Indigenous ancestry more wholly.
